Use a light, neutral grasp on all of your golf clubs. Your shots will drift to the right if you grip the golf club tightly. If you do not hold your club tight enough, the ball will veer to the left. You will be able to find just the right grip by watching whether your shots veer left or right.

When you are driving, the back of the front foot should align with the ball. For other swings, position yourself so that the golf ball is evenly between your feet. The only exception to this generalization is when your ball is on an incline.

The face of your club should be squared up with the ball as you take your shot. This helps the ball travel in a straight line. If the club hits the ball at an angle, the ball will fly away from the club at an angle as well. Experiment with how you hold the club until you have mastered hitting the ball at a 90 degree angle.
